随着人工智能技术的快速发展,越来越多的用户希望能够在自己的设备上创建和运行 AI 智能体。特别是对于拥有 NVIDIA RTX 显卡的用户来说,利用其强大的计算能力来开发本地 AI 智能体变得更加可行和高效。本文将详细介绍如何在 NVIDIA RTX PC 上创建本地 AI 智能体,帮助您充分发挥硬件的潜力。

一、了解 NVIDIA RTX 的优势
NVIDIA RTX 显卡配备了强大的图形处理能力和专门的 AI 处理单元,使其在深度学习和机器学习任务中表现出色。通过 GPU 加速,您可以显著缩短训练时间,提高 AI 模型的效率。此外,NVIDIA 的 CUDA 平台和深度学习库(如 TensorFlow 和 PyTorch)使得开发工作更加便捷。
二、准备工作环境
在开始创建本地 AI 智能体之前,您需要确保您的 NVIDIA RTX PC 已安装最新的驱动程序和必要的软件。您可以访问 NVIDIA 的官方网站,下载并安装最新的驱动程序。此外,安装 Anaconda 或 Miniconda 可以帮助您更好地管理 Python 环境和依赖库。

三、选择合适的 AI 框架
在创建 AI 智能体时,选择合适的深度学习框架至关重要。TensorFlow 和 PyTorch 是当前最受欢迎的两个框架,具有强大的社区支持和丰富的文档。根据您的项目需求和个人偏好,选择一个合适的框架可以提高开发效率。
四、创建本地 AI 智能体的步骤
1. **环境配置**:使用 Anaconda 创建一个新的环境,并安装所需的库和框架。
2. **数据准备**:收集和准备训练数据,确保数据的质量和多样性。
3. **模型设计**:根据任务需求设计 AI 模型的架构,可以参考已有的模型进行调整。
4. **模型训练**:利用 NVIDIA RTX 的计算能力进行模型训练,监控训练过程中的损失和准确率。
5. **模型评估**:训练完成后,使用验证集评估模型性能,并进行必要的优化。
6. **部署与使用**:将训练好的模型部署到您的应用中,进行实际测试和使用。
五、常见问题及解决方案
在创建本地 AI 智能体的过程中,您可能会遇到各种问题,如环境配置错误、模型训练不收敛等。建议您积极查阅相关文档和社区资源,许多问题在网上都有解决方案。此外,定期更新驱动程序和库版本可以避免一些不必要的兼容性问题。

结论
在 NVIDIA RTX PC 上创建本地 AI 智能体是一项具有挑战性但充满乐趣的任务。通过合理的准备和选择,您可以充分利用强大的硬件资源,开发出高效的 AI 应用。希望本文提供的步骤和建议能帮助您顺利完成项目,实现您的 AI 创意。